State Government / Tennessee / Legislation / SB 2367

SB 2367Session 114SenateBecame law

County Government - As enacted, applies the Neighborhood Preservation Act to Tipton County; authorizes Montgomery County and Tipton County to participate in the Tennessee Local Land Bank Program. - Amends TCA Title 5 and Title 13.
